Trong những năm gần đây, trí tuệ nhân tạo (AI) đã và đang tác động mạnh mẽ đến quy trình phát triển phần mềm. Một trong những xu hướng nổi bật gần đây chính là Vibe Coding – một khái niệm mới mẻ được đề xuất bởi Andrej Karpathy, cựu Giám đốc AI của Tesla. Vibe Coding hứa hẹn thay đổi cách chúng ta hiểu về lập trình và có thể tạo nên một bước ngoặt lớn cho ngành Business Analysis. Bài viết này, cùng BAC tìm hiểu rõ hơn về tư duy Vibe Coding: cơ hội mới cho business analyst trong kỷ nguyên AI nhé.

1. Vibe Coding là gì?

Vibe Coding không giống với lập trình truyền thống hay lập trình hỗ trợ bởi AI thông thường. Đây là nơi người tạo ra phần mềm chỉ cần trò chuyện với AI bằng ngôn ngữ tự nhiên (có thể qua văn bản hoặc thậm chí bằng giọng nói) để mô tả những gì mình muốn. AI sẽ đảm nhiệm toàn bộ phần còn lại: viết mã, xử lý lỗi, tối ưu giải pháp… mà không cần con người phải can thiệp vào từng dòng code. Người dùng không cần biết lập trình, cũng không cần kiểm tra code, chỉ cần tập trung vào ý tưởng và để AI thực thi.

Karpathy mô tả trạng thái này như một sự cộng tác lười biếng nhưng hiệu quả: khi gặp lỗi, ông chỉ sao chép thông báo lỗi và dán vào khung hội thoại, để AI tự khắc phục. Đây không còn là coding theo nghĩa truyền thống, mà là một trải nghiệm hoàn toàn mới.

2. Tương lai của Vibe Coding: Cơ hội hay trào lưu?

Dù nhận được sự quan tâm lớn từ cộng đồng công nghệ, Vibe Coding vẫn đang vấp phải nhiều tranh cãi. Một mặt, nó mở ra khả năng tăng tốc phát triển phần mềm và giảm tải công việc kỹ thuật cho con người. Mặt khác, câu hỏi về chất lượng, bảo mật và trách nhiệm khi sử dụng mã do AI tạo ra vẫn là dấu hỏi lớn.

Tuy vậy, chúng ta không thể phủ nhận tiềm năng ứng dụng của xu hướng này. Và đối với cộng đồng Business Analyst – những người đóng vai trò kết nối giữa công nghệ và doanh nghiệp thì việc thấu hiểu và ứng dụng Vibe Coding đúng cách có thể mang lại giá trị vượt bậc.

3. Làm mới quy trình tạo prototype: Tương tác trực tiếp, phản hồi tức thì

Ở các giai đoạn đầu của dự án, BA thường phải tạo mockup giao diện để mô phỏng hệ thống. Trước đây, điều này đòi hỏi kỹ năng thiết kế hoặc sự hỗ trợ từ UX/UI team. Vibe Coding thay đổi hoàn toàn cách tiếp cận này.

Chỉ cần diễn tả bằng ngôn ngữ tự nhiên những yêu cầu về giao diện chẳng hạn như một form đăng ký người dùng. AI có thể ngay lập tức tạo ra một phiên bản HTML/CSS với luồng điều hướng  sinh động. Khi họp với stakeholder, BA có thể chỉnh sửa trực tiếp theo phản hồi (“tăng kích thước chữ”, “đổi màu nền”), từ đó rút ngắn chu trình phản hồi và tăng mức độ tương tác.

Việc mẫu thử trở nên “sống động” giúp người dùng cuối dễ hình dung và đóng góp hiệu quả hơn, thay vì chỉ đọc tài liệu hoặc xem hình ảnh tĩnh.

4. Hỗ trợ đắc lực cho BA trong các tác vụ liên quan đến lập trình

Nhiều BA từng gặp khó khăn khi cần thực hiện các công việc kỹ thuật như viết truy vấn SQL, xử lý dữ liệu, chuyển đổi định dạng, hay tự động hóa báo cáo. Với Vibe Coding, chỉ cần một dòng mô tả: “Lấy danh sách 10 khách hàng mua nhiều nhất trong quý 2” hay “Chuyển file CSV này thành định dạng JSON theo từng khách hàng”

AI thậm chí có thể viết đoạn mã cần thiết hoặc thực hiện luôn thao tác chuyển đổi. Điều này không chỉ giúp những BA không chuyên về code tiết kiệm thời gian, mà còn giảm phụ thuộc vào developer hay data analyst trong các tác vụ đơn giản.

Dù vậy, BA vẫn cần có năng lực thẩm định đầu ra để đảm bảo dữ liệu chính xác và logic, bởi AI có thể tạo ra kết quả “trông hợp lý” nhưng đi ngược hoàn toàn với bản chất nghiệp vụ.

5. Minh họa yêu cầu rõ ràng hơn: Giao tiếp qua trải nghiệm thay vì lý thuyết

Một trong những thách thức lớn nhất trong nghề BA là làm sao để stakeholder hiểu đúng yêu cầu. Trước đây, chúng ta dùng đến user story, wireframe, hoặc flowchart. Và tất cả đều cần sự tưởng tượng từ người đọc.

Giờ đây, BA có thể tạo ra các minh chứng chức năng thực tế để trình bày. Một hệ thống đặt hàng đơn giản, một quy trình phê duyệt đơn hàng, hoặc một trang đăng nhập hoạt động được.  Tất cả đều có thể được tạo ra tức thì bằng prompt. Stakeholder không còn phải hình dung, họ có thể nhấn vào, thử nghiệm, và phản hồi cụ thể. Từ đó, việc ghi nhận, điều chỉnh và xác minh yêu cầu trở nên chính xác và nhanh chóng hơn rất nhiều.

6. Vai trò của BA trong thời đại mới  
Trong bối cảnh AI xử lý ngày càng tốt các công việc mang tính lặp lại và kỹ thuật, BA có cơ hội dịch chuyển vai trò từ “người viết tài liệu” sang “người định hướng giá trị”. Vibe Coding chính là cơ hội để giải phóng năng lực tư duy, cho phép BA tập trung vào những câu hỏi lớn:
  • Tại sao doanh nghiệp cần hệ thống này?
  • Giá trị nào sẽ được tạo ra?
  • Làm sao để tối ưu trải nghiệm người dùng cuối?

Thay vì bị cuốn vào chi tiết kỹ thuật, BA có thể dẫn dắt đội nhóm và stakeholder theo một hướng chiến lược hơn, lấy con người và mục tiêu kinh doanh làm trọng tâm.

Thực tế Vibe Coding không thể hoàn toàn thay thế BA, nó chỉ làm nổi bật giá trị của BA hiện đại. Không ai có thể chắc chắn rằng Vibe Coding sẽ thay đổi toàn bộ ngành công nghiệp phần mềm. Nhưng một điều rõ ràng: những người biết tận dụng AI sẽ luôn có lợi thế.

Với Vibe Coding, người BA có thể nhanh chóng tạo mẫu, tương tác hiệu quả, xử lý tác vụ kỹ thuật và làm rõ yêu cầu bằng cách trực quan nhất. Nhưng hơn hết, công cụ này làm nổi bật một điều cốt lõi: BA không chỉ là người chuyên về tài liệu hay đặc tả mà là người định hình sản phẩm, kết nối các bên liên quan.

AI không phải là mối đe dọa, mà là đòn bẩy giúp Business Analyst bước vào một kỷ nguyên mới, nơi kỹ năng phân tích, giao tiếp và tư duy chiến lược càng trở nên quan trọng hơn bao giờ hết. Hãy tiếp tục cập nhật những kiến thức mới nhất liên quan đến BA tại BAC's Blog bạn nhé.

 

Nguồn tham khảo:
https://modernanalyst.com

Nhu cầu đào tạo doanh nghiệp

BAC là đơn vị đào tạo BA đầu tiên tại Việt Nam. Đối tác chính thức của IIBA quốc tế. Ngoài các khóa học public, BAC còn có các khóa học in house dành riêng cho từng doanh nghiệp. Chương trình được thiết kế riêng theo yêu cầu của doanh nghiệp, giúp doanh nghiệp giải quyết những khó khăn và tư vấn phát triển.
 

CÁC KHOÁ HỌC BUSINESS ANALYST BACs.VN DÀNH CHO BẠN

Khoá học Online:

Khoá học Offline:

Tại Tp.HCM:

Tại Hà Nội:

Tham khảo lịch khai giảng TẤT CẢ các khóa học mới nhất

Ban biên tập nội dung - BAC